Extra Curricular Activities

We offer a range of after school clubs which support children’s creative, academic and sporting interests.

At Hayfield Lane every year children in each year group take part in a range of trips to support teaching and learning. Educational visits have included

visits to the ButterflyHouse,YorkshireWildlife Park,The Deep,Harry Potter StudioTour London andTheNational Space Centre to name but a few.

As well as these visits children inYear 6 participate in an annual residential trip. Some of the places they have visited include London and France.

Taking Risks

The ability to take a risk, feeling secure in the knowledge that tomakemistakes is a crucial step in learning, is a value that we hold close to our hearts

at Hayfield Lane. Solid foundations allowour children to take chances, try new things, celebrate changes and step outside their comfort zones into

places that challenge themas learners and as people.This ethos ismodelled by all members of staff and extends to howwe teach, lead and plan for

the future.
